I’ve been using Tealium Customer Data Hub mainly to unify and activate client data across CRM, billing and marketing systems. We also use it to manage server-side and client-side pixels for over a thousand domains and we have also started using Event Stream to capture more data on the server side.
Tealium is for teams who need to unify customer data and want something reliable and it’s probably best for larger companies that have the tech resources to get the most out of it, also if you deal with a lot of domains or data sources, this really helps bring it all together.

Tealium Customer Data Hub has been able to provide advanced segmentation that has allowed us to effectively reduce our ad spend while simultaneously increasing the quality of leads that we are generating by targeting key user groups. We have been able to do this by audience suppression and look-alike audiences targeting these key user groups. Along with this, we have been able to increase our signals that we are sending to different advertisers by leveraging event stream and Capi integrations.

We use Tealium Event Stream to stream realtime conversion data to a number of different CAPI solutions. We've seen increased ROAS with these implementations which have only driven more need for more CAPI solutions / connectors to be put in place. With the 3rd party cookies going away soon, and increased privacy regulations with software updates (ioS 17, etc) we're noticing a loss of data capture that we were previsouly getting. The CAPI solution has helped with that. Our scope of Event Stream is pretty limited to CAPI, but we have other smaller use cases for sending real time data as well.
